Cutting mats! With a new design on one side too! Just like the last one I did many years ago, this is double sided with a metric grid (red) on one side, and an imperial grid (white) on the other. It's 3mm thick with a black core, and is self healing. Oh, and it's A2 size, so it's nice and big! I hope everyone is excited for these!
Last week I mentioned how I was working with a carpenter to create a Trapped Under Plastic sign for the background of the podcast. The logo we use for our podcast is pretty cool, but it needed some work.
You can see how when you remove the surrounding sprue, the letters just seem a little awkward. We could try to remake the entire logo in a more "sign friendly" format, but I feel like that would be kind of challenging with the amount of 3D detail in the illustration. So, I came up with this simplification.
I took the high-res file from the illustrator, converted it to paths, sharpened up all the lines/corners, and made some modifications to some letters so that they would puzzle-piece together more closely. The letters will be cut out separately and the grey sprue-thing will be one piece that they all attach to behind it. The letters themselves will have some LEDs behind them, and then actual sprues (donated from viewers) will get attached behind the grey support structure filling out all the white space. The whole assembly will then be attached to the wall behind us. It's going to look so cool; I'm excited!
